A Stark Warning From The Experts

Following the rescue, the RNLI issued a urgent safety reminder to all coastal visitors. "Tides can come in far quicker than many people anticipate, often cutting off walkers in a matter of minutes," a spokesperson said. "We urge everyone to check tide times before heading out, to be aware of your surroundings, and to always carry a means of calling for help."
